Preguntas frecuentes sobre Southwest Berkeley

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Southwest Berkeley?

Actualmente hay 202 Apartamentos Estudios en Southwest Berkeley con alquileres que van desde $1,500 hasta $2,895, con un precio medio de $2,312.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Southwest Berkeley?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Southwest Berkeley varian entre $950 y $3,996 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,866

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Southwest Berkeley?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Southwest Berkeley van desde $2,195 hasta $6,558.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,971
